Joe Huang is a scholar working on Building and Construction, Environmental Engineering and Social Psychology. According to data from OpenAlex, Joe Huang has authored 16 papers receiving a total of 517 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Building and Construction, 6 papers in Environmental Engineering and 2 papers in Social Psychology. Recurrent topics in Joe Huang's work include Building Energy and Comfort Optimization (12 papers), Urban Heat Island Mitigation (5 papers) and Smart Grid Energy Management (2 papers). Joe Huang is often cited by papers focused on Building Energy and Comfort Optimization (12 papers), Urban Heat Island Mitigation (5 papers) and Smart Grid Energy Management (2 papers). Joe Huang collaborates with scholars based in United States, China and Japan. Joe Huang's co-authors include Haider Taha, Arthur H. Rosenfeld, Hashem Akbari, Qingyuan Zhang, D. Arasteh, Joshua S. Apte, John G. Ingersoll, Hongxing Yang, Moncef Krarti and Pengyuan Shen and has published in prestigious journals such as Energy Policy, Energy and Buildings and Building and Environment.
